Tarea para un detective

Resulta que desde un servidor de correo algo desactualizado, se reciben correos repetitivos… por ejemplo, un correo de un tema determinado, y varios otros diciendo que ese correo tuvo dificultades para ser entregado, y que un mensaje a postmaster se le reenvía de nuevo a sí mismo…. Sigue leyendo

Publicado en Software Libre | Deja un comentario

De nuevo luchando con Linux en MacBook

Hube de cambiar la MacBook Pro por una MacBook 4,1 y empezó una nueva aventura…

Cambié el disco duro de una Mac a la otra y prácticamente todo funcionó, excepto la tarjeta WIFI. Ni la detectó.  Pero esta historia tiene un final feliz… Sigue leyendo

Publicado en Software Libre | Deja un comentario

Otro problemita, esta vez de Windows

Saltar a: navegación, buscar

Que no es el tipo de problemas que acostumbro a poner aquí, pero es que me hizo dudar si mi controlador de dominio con Samba 4 tenía problemas. 

Sigue leyendo

Publicado en Software Libre | Deja un comentario

Cuando no se habla claro…

Estaba tratando de acceder a una base de datos MS SQL mediante PHP 7.4  en Debian 11 según lo que había hecho siempre en PHP 5.x, y me topé con que las cosas han cambiado.

Ahora es necesario descargarse un driver desde el sitio de Microsoft, y compilarlo. Y justo ahí empezaron las dificultades…

Sigue leyendo

Publicado en Software Libre | Deja un comentario

El necesario mantenimiento… que no siempre hacemos

Resulta que hace dos días tuve la desagradable sorpresa de encontrarme con que la PC del trabajo no podía abrir sesión.  Vaya cosa. Y cuando me pongo a averiguar el por qué, me dice que la partición /dev/sda1 está llena…

Sigue leyendo

Publicado en Software Libre | Deja un comentario

Detallitos que siempre olvido…

A los que ya no tenemos tan buena vista como antes, se nos hace difícil a veces distinguir la información buscada dentro de un bloque de texto. Por ejemplo, al querer eliminar una tarea de la cual solo tenemos una vaga idea del nombre y la buscamos con ps, o revisando dmesg para saber si un dispositivo fue identificado. Sigue leyendo

Publicado en Software Libre | Deja un comentario

Consultando una base de datos PostgreSQL por correo

 
Saltar a: navegación, buscar

Uf! Hace rato que no encontraba tiempo para dedicarlo a este blog. Espero que esta información les sea útil, o al menos les dé ideas.

Para el caso nuestro, que tenemos los usuarios bajo /home, pues son relativamente pocos, se pueden aprovechar las bondades del procmail.

Creamos un usuario pregunta bajo /home, y ponemos esto en un fichero .procmailrc:

TEMA=`formail -x Subject:`

:1 h

* !^X-Loop: pregunta@correo.cu

|( formail -r -I”Precedence: junk” \ -A”X-Loop: pregunta@correo.cu”; \ /usr/bin/psql -h 192.168.0.144 -d postgres -A -F, –username=periquito  -c “select * from tabla where numero= `echo ${TEMA}`” ) | $SENDMAIL -t

Es necesario tener en ese directorio un fichero .pgpass, con la información:

servidor:puerto:base:usuario:contraseña

perteneciente a pregunta y con permisos 600.

Con esto, ya tenemos un modelo sencillo que funciona. Un mensaje a la cuenta pregunta@correo.cu con la línea de asunto 46 devolverá los datos del item 46 en la tabla consultada.

Sigue leyendo

Publicado en Software Libre | 2 comentarios

Compatibilizando charsets…

En nuestro sistema de control de producción (PHP+PostgreSQL) tenemos en ocasiones que presentar conjuntamente  datos extraídos de distintos programas(Fastos, Versat) además del nuestro. Esto, además de obligarnos a trabajar simultáneamente con distintos tipos de bases de datos (PostgreSQL, MSSQL) nos añade la dificultad de presentar correctamente en pantalla distintos juegos de caracteres (charsets)…

Sigue leyendo

Publicado en Software Libre | Deja un comentario

Soluciones que conviene tener a mano

Hay problemas que resolvemos, y con el tiempo se nos olvida cómo. Luego volvemos a encontrarlos, y hay que repensar todo. Hoy saco del cajón de los recuerdos cómo oír una estación de radio con VLC detrás de un proxy, y cómo averiguar la MAC de la tarjeta de un equipo remoto (que me queda bien remoto, incluyendo escaleras).

Sigue leyendo

Publicado en Software Libre | Deja un comentario

Se nos ha ido uno de los buenos

Reproduzco esta noticia del sitio GUTL:

 

Fallece Maikel Llamaret, uno de los impulsores del Software Libre en Cuba

En horas de la madrugada de este lunes falleció, Maikel Llamaret Heredia, uno de los principales impulsores del software libre en Cuba, creador del Proyecto SWL-X y coadministrador de la Web del Grupo de Usuarios de Tecnologías Libres en Cuba (GUTL).

Sigue leyendo

Publicado en Software Libre | Deja un comentario